WebShrimp are bottom-feeding omnivores, eating most organic materials – animal or plant – they encounter at the bottom. Smaller shrimp pick food off the sediment while larger shrimp become predators, feeding on polychaete worms, amphipods, nematodes, crustacean larvae, isopods, copepods, small fishes, grass shrimp, fiddler crabs, and squareback crabs.

Rock shrimp may be found from Norfolk, Virginia, south across the Gulf of Mexico to the Yucatan Peninsula in Mexico. Typically, they are taken by trawling using strengthened nets that are resistant to abrasion from coral and rocky bottoms, which are where the shrimp are captured.
